Transaction 491785ab5ebd59bb2a6a089456309be2b3c18c936bbd4d2696367122a40f0a77
1 Input
1 Output
-
491785ab5ebd59bb2a6a089456309be2b3c18c936bbd4d2696367122a40f0a77:0
- value
- 1858015
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0d37d4a1cee42c719d85e336d95bd36da5b0709 OP_EQUAL
- address
- 3LjBpzAfXds7RRrWSugCFiDoSGzGYefrYE